Country overviewOn January 7, 2026 at 04:38 UTC, a magnitude M3.4 earthquake occurred near Caraga, Davao Oriental (Philippines). With a focal depth of about 24 km, this was a shallow earthquake, whose shaking is usually felt more strongly at the surface. Earthquakes of this magnitude are often felt but rarely cause damage.
The event was recorded by EMSC. Philippines: over the past 24 hours, QuakeMap24 logged 6 earthquakes, the strongest at M4.3.
